Capital Investment Counsel Inc grew its holdings in shares of Cracker Barrel Old Country Store, Inc. (NASDAQ:CBRL - Free Report) by 53.2% in the first qu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 28,442 shares of the restaurant operator's stock after acquiring an additional 9,875 shares during the quarter. Capital Investment Counsel Inc owned about 0.13% of Cracker Barrel Old Country Store worth $1,104,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Cracker Barrel Old Country Store (NASDAQ:CBRL -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, June 5th. The restaurant operator reported $0.58 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.17 by $0.41. The firm had revenue of $821.10 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$824.65 million. Cracker Barrel Old Country Store had a return on equity of 16.83% and a net margin of 1.65%. The business's revenue for the quarter was up .5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the company earned $0.88 earnings per share. On average, equities research analysts expect that Cracker Barrel Old Country Store, Inc. will post 2.76 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Cracker Barrel Old Country Store Company Profile

Cracker Barrel Old Country Store, Inc develops and operates the Cracker Barrel Old Country Store concept in the United States. Its Cracker Barrel stores consist of restaurants with a gift shop. The company's restaurants serve breakfast, lunch, and dinner daily, as well as dine-in, pick-up, and delivery services.
